CODE Informatics is seeking an HR Intern to support CSR initiatives, charity operations, and community engagement activities. This paid 6-month internship offers an opportunity for a full-time role based on performance.
The ideal candidate should have a BBA/MBA (HRM), alongside strong communication and coordination skills.
Responsibilities include:
- Assisting in CSR campaigns
- Donor coordination
- Organizing charity events

How to prepare for a job interview at CODE Informatics
✨Know Your CSR Stuff
Before the interview, brush up on CODE Informatics' CSR initiatives and community engagement activities. Being able to discuss their current projects shows genuine interest and helps you stand out as a candidate who’s already aligned with their mission.
✨Show Off Your Communication Skills
Since strong communication is key for this role, prepare examples of how you've effectively communicated in past experiences. Whether it’s coordinating events or working with donors, having specific anecdotes ready will demonstrate your capabilities.
✨Be Ready to Discuss Teamwork
This internship involves a lot of collaboration, so be prepared to talk about your experience working in teams. Highlight any charity events or group projects you've been part of, focusing on your role and how you contributed to the team's success.
✨Ask Thoughtful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about upcoming CSR campaigns or how the team measures the impact of their initiatives. This not only shows your enthusiasm but also gives you insight into the company culture.
